采用高低匹配机制的发电权交易市场中发电公司的竞价策略

摘    要:发电权交易有利于优化电源结构,促进节能减排,在国内电力系统领域得到比较普遍的应用。发电公司在发电权交易市场中所采用的竞价策略直接影响其收益,因而是发电公司关注的重要问题。在此背景下,针对采用高低匹配机制的发电权集中竞价交易市场,发展了计及风险的发电公司的竞价策略。首先,建立了评估发电权交易双方的成本和收益的数学模型。之后,构建了发电公司参与采用高低匹配机制的发电权交易市场的计及风险的最优竞价策略的优化模型,并采用蒙特卡洛仿真方法求解。最后,用算例对所构造的最优竞价策略模型和采用的方法进行说明,并分析了发电权交易其他参与者的报价行为对所研究的发电公司最优报价策略的影响。

Bidding Strategy for Generation Companies Participating in Generation-Right Trading Market Employing High-Low Matching Mechanism
Abstract:Generation-right trade is an efficient approach for optimizing the power structure and promoting energy conservation and emission reduction, which is widely used in domestic power industry. The adopted bidding strategies of generation companies in the generation-right trading market could have significant impacts on their profits, which is an important issue for the generation companies. Under this background, this paper develops a risk-constrained optimal bidding strategy for generation companies based on the centrally bidding platform of generation-right trade market employing the high-low matching mechanism. Firstly, we construct the mathematical model to evaluate the costs and benefits for both sides participating in the generation-right trade. Then, we construct the optimization model of the risk-constrained optimal bidding strategy for generation companies participating in generating-right trading market based on the high-low matching mechanism, which can be solved by Monte Carlo simulation method. Finally, we adopt a numerical example to demonstrate the proposed optimal bidding strategy model and the presented method, and analyze the impacts of bidding behaviors of other power companies on the optimal bidding strategy of the studied power company.
